Observe Your IP Accost Using Command Prompt

If you like working with Control Prompt, good news! There's a uncomplicated control that you tin can run to get your IP address.

Get-go, open Command Prompt. To do so, blazon "Control Prompt" in the Windows search bar and click the Control Prompt app that appears in the search results.

Type "Command Prompt" in the Windows search bar and click the Command Prompt app.

Control Prompt will open up. Type this command and press Enter to execute it:

ipconfig

Run ipconfig from Command Prompt.

Your IP address will be returned in the response, listed in the "IPv4 Accost" line.

Your IP address in the Command Prompt response.
